The Initial Step: Knowing What You Have


Prior to anything else, it's important to understand the true nature of your item. This is where the duty of fine art appraisers becomes main. These professionals have an eye for detail and the historic knowledge to examine authenticity, problem, provenance, and market value. A trustworthy appraisal does not simply tell you what something could be worth-- it also aids identify where it suits the existing market landscape.


State, as an example, you have a painting passed down via generations or a sculpture you acquired overseas. A fine art evaluator can aid differentiate whether it's a desired original or a less-valuable reproduction. This fundamental assessment establishes the tone for the whole consignment process and guarantees that your assumptions are straightened with the item's actual worth.

The Consignment Agreement: Setting the Terms


Once the item has been professionally appraised, the next phase entails the consignment arrangement. This paper outlines the terms, including book prices (the minimum quantity you're ready to approve), compensation structures, and promotional initiatives. A great consignment partner will certainly walk you with these details, guaranteeing openness every action of the way.


It's not nearly turning over your item-- it's regarding getting in a collaboration. When you consign your work to a respectable auction gallery, they become your advocate. From photographing your piece under ideal lighting to crafting compelling brochure descriptions, their goal is to provide your item in the most effective possible light to potential purchasers.

What Happens After the Gavel Falls?


When the item is sold, you'll obtain a thorough negotiation statement describing the last hammer rate, compensations, and your web proceeds. Settlement is commonly made within a defined window, and you're frequently allowed to consign added products for future auctions.
